Output 24f1360817034d26d35036f20399f8c86df7419fd8d57b9081b53784ecdfb959:0

value
12550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755febe8360f113e1e111bf8eeaae7cb81c3f034 OP_EQUAL
address
3CPdtjNiBcWVeWVe4BpNtAQEAFF7rwDZPG
transaction
24f1360817034d26d35036f20399f8c86df7419fd8d57b9081b53784ecdfb959
spent
true